Eyewear Suppliers in South Carolina

Eyewear Suppliers
eyewear supplier
Lenscrafters #838

     Eyewear Supplier
101 Verdae Blvd, Greenville, SC 29607
864-676-1122    
eyewear supplier
Eyemart Express Ltd

     Eyewear Supplier
1137 Woodruff Rd Ste A, Greenville, SC 29607
864-438-2075     864-438-2082
eyewear supplier
Lenscrafters #047

     Eyewear Supplier
700 Haywood Rd Ste 2018e, Greenville, SC 29607
864-234-7200    
eyewear supplier
Usv Optical Inc.

     Eyewear Supplier
700 Haywood, Greenville, SC 29607
864-297-7445    
eyewear supplier
Warby Parker Inc.

     Eyewear Supplier
14 N Main Street, Greenville, SC 29601
855-550-0743    
eyewear supplier
Vision Center 30-0640

     Eyewear Supplier
1451 Woodruff Rd, Greenville, SC 29607
864-297-3031    
eyewear supplier
America's Best Contacts & Eyeglasses

     Eyewear Supplier
617 Haywood Rd, Greenville, SC 29607
864-627-9500    
eyewear supplier
Vision Center 30-0641

     Eyewear Supplier
6134 White Horse Rd, Greenville, SC 29611
864-295-3181    
eyewear supplier
Vision Center 30-1382

     Eyewear Supplier
508 Bypass 72 Nw, Greenwood, SC 29649
864-229-2232    
eyewear supplier
Walmart Vision Center 30-6887

     Eyewear Supplier
300 Bypass 25 Ne, Greenwood, SC 29646
864-321-6030    
eyewear supplier
Stanton Optical

     Eyewear Supplier
1322 W Wade Hampton Blvd, Greer, SC 29650
864-416-0320     561-828-8367
eyewear supplier
Southern Eye Optical Llc

     Eyewear Supplier
100 Physicians Dr, Greer, SC 29650
864-269-3333     864-295-1288
eyewear supplier
Eastside Eyecare

     Eyewear Supplier
2411 Hudson Rd, Eastside Eyecare, Greer, SC 29650
864-881-1393     864-752-1046
eyewear supplier
Southern Eye Associates, Pa

     Eyewear Supplier
100 Physicians Dr, Greer, SC 29650
864-269-3333     864-295-1288
eyewear supplier
Vision Center 30-2687

     Eyewear Supplier
14055 E Wade Hampton Blvd, Greer, SC 29651
864-877-1928    
Eyewear Supplier: An organization that provides spectacles, contact lenses, and other vision enhancement devices prescribed by an optometrist or ophthalmologist. They provide only equipments not the service.